Abstract

The present invention relates to providing control information within a search space for blind decoding in a multi-carrier communication system. In particular, the control information is carried within a sub-frame of the communication system, the sub-frame including a plurality of control channel elements. The control channel elements may be aggregated into candidates for blind decoding. The number of control channel elements in a candidate is called aggregation level. In accordance with the present invention, the candidates of lower aggregation levels are localized, meaning that the control channel elements of one candidate are located adjacently to each other in the frequency domain. Some candidates of the higher aggregation level(s) are distributed in the frequency.

Claims (18)

1. A reception method comprising:

receiving a signal including downlink control information mapped to a search space, the search space including a plurality of candidates for mapping the downlink control information by a transmission apparatus, and each candidate including a control channel element (CCE) or a plurality of aggregated CCEs, wherein a first aggregation level value for localized allocation where CCE(s) included in a candidate are localized in a frequency domain is smaller than a second aggregation level value for distributed allocation where CCEs included in the candidate are at least partially distributed in the frequency domain, and wherein the search space is configured on a data region of a downlink subframe; and

decoding the search space to obtain the downlink control information that is mapped to one of the plurality of candidates included in the search space.

2. The reception method according to claim 1 , wherein the first aggregation level value is a value indicating a maximum aggregation level available for the localized allocation and the second aggregation level value is a value indicating a maximum aggregation level available for distributed allocation.

3. The reception method according to claim 1 , wherein the first aggregation level value is a value indicating an aggregation level used for the localized allocation and the second aggregation level value is a value indicating an aggregation level used for distributed allocation.

4. The reception method according to claim 1 , wherein the search space only includes candidates for the localized allocation or only includes candidates for the distributed allocation.

5. The reception method according to claim 1 , wherein a single search space includes a candidate for the localized allocation and another candidate for the distributed allocation.

6. The reception method according to claim 1 , wherein the downlink control information includes uplink grant and downlink assignment information.

7. The reception method according to claim 1 , wherein the first aggregation level value is 1 or 2 and the second aggregation level value is 4 or 8.

8. A reception apparatus comprising:

a receiving section configured to receive a signal including downlink control information mapped to a search space, the search space including a plurality of candidates for mapping the downlink control information by a transmission apparatus, and each candidate including a control channel element (CCE) or a plurality of aggregated CCEs, wherein a first aggregation level value for localized allocation where CCE(s) included in a candidate are localized in a frequency domain is smaller than a second aggregation level value for distributed allocation where CCEs included in the candidate are at least partially distributed in the frequency domain, and wherein the search space is configured on a data region of a downlink subframe; and

decoding section configured to decode the search space to obtain the downlink control information that is mapped to one of the plurality of candidates included in the search space.
